If you have a penchant for recording your calls, but can’t organize your VHS collection, then you might wanna consider this handy (no pun intended) device. The FeaturePhone 175 Call Recorder can store up to 175 hours of calls on one disc, store 500 contacts, and includes a built in answering machine. The phone can also double as a voice recording for your doctor-like-dictations. According to RedFerret it will cost you $900.
